We spent 2 days in Long Beach prior to boarding the ship. The free bus around Long Beach was very useful - really did not need a car. We had flown into LAX and then took Uber to the Queen Mary. Uber was a great experience - our first time using this service. Recommend it highly - cost was less then cost of the shuttles. Had never been on the Miracle, but had traveled on the Legend 2 times. Liked the size of the ship. We felt the décor of the ship was "different" but not horrible. The crew decorated the ship for the holidays and it was impressive. We thoroughly enjoyed the holiday décor and the celebrations. This was our first time being Platinum and we enjoyed the "special" treatment. Embarkation was a treat - buffet was not crowded. We do Any Time Dining and shared a table all but one time - it was a great way to meet different individuals and enabled us to have interesting conversations. Entertainment was wonderful - the dancers/singers were great and very personable. Thoroughly enjoyed the offered enrichment on this Journey cruise - Nancy the naturalist, Steven Katkowsky, Academy of Fun, the juggler's, mentalist's, the Hawaiian representatives - they all made sea days and evenings fly by...

Adam and the Fun Squad made trivia, games, and events around the ship so much fun. Dining and Lido staff were attentive and friendly. Sea Day Brunches are always enjoyable. Dining staff "shows" were fun.

We rented cars in all but 2 ports. We rented from Dollar - the cars were fine, our recommendation is that you do not use Dollar's toll free number...the reliable information on this number leaves a lot to be desired. Did an excursion in Kauai - NaPali Cruise and Snorkel. This was a wonderful tour. Snorkeling was limited due to high winds and waves but traveling along the NaPali coast line was terrific - got to see tail of one whale, spinner dolphins and a sea turtle. While on Oahu we snorkeled at Hanauma Bay Nature Preserve - this is a great place to see lots of fish - no standing on the coral reefs but it is an easy place to snorkel right from the shore.

In side cabin - sufficient storage - suitcases fit under the bed. Were able to get extra hangers - enabled us to hang everything we needed to hang up. We were initally fearful that we would hear alot of noise from the 9th deck (cleaning/moving of lounge chairs at night) - the weather was not cooperative - so there were not alot of outdoor activities.
